What is FileTopia?

FileTopia is an open source file sharing and syncing software that allows you to host your own private cloud storage server. With FileTopia, you get full control over your data and can securely share files with others.

Some key features of FileTopia include:

  • Easy to install and configure - It can be installed on common Linux distributions like Ubuntu, Debian, CentOS.
  • Web-based interface - Manage users, files, permissions through an intuitive web UI.
  • Role-based access control - Assign roles and permissions to users and user groups.
  • Secure file transfers - All data encrypted in transit and at rest.
  • File versioning - Track history of file changes.
  • Mobile apps - Android and iOS apps allow access on the go.
  • Open source - Developed openly on GitHub under AGPL license.

By leveraging FileTopia to create your own on-premise file server, you get full data ownership and privacy. Easy collaboration across teams with comprehensive access controls make it useful for personal as well as business use.
